Output 046833c02262487247733b0424dffbff235cdbd2cb47324f8987e49f9855d4fd:3

value
640659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bb54bfcf4242678ba585ccb5e611274a84bd23 OP_EQUAL
address
3FhsitCFYWBLdFBvrKz9cG2XweHk7Xg2K7
transaction
046833c02262487247733b0424dffbff235cdbd2cb47324f8987e49f9855d4fd
spent
true